Sally who weighs 450 N, stands on a skate board while roger pushes it forward 13.0 m at constant velocity on a level straight street. He applies a constant 100 N force.

Work done on the skateboard

a. Rodger Work= 0J

b. Rodger work= 1300J

c. sally work= 1300J

d. sally work= 5850J

e. rodger work= 5850J

    Answer:

    b. Rodger work = 1300 J

    Explanation:

    Work done: This can be defined as the product of force and distance along the direction of the force.

    From the question,

    Work is done by Rodger using a force of 100 N  in pushing the skateboard through a distance of 13.0 m.

    W = F×d…………. Equation 1

    Where W = work done, F = force, d = distance.

    Given: F = 100 N, d = 13 m

    Substitute these values into equation 1

    W = 100(13)

    W = 1300 J.

    Hence the right option is b. Rodger work = 1300 J
